Will AI Replace Logistics Coordinators? 60/100 Risk Score
Logistics Coordinators currently score 60/100 on AI displacement risk — high exposure. McKinsey and World Economic Forum data suggest 190K U.S. jobs in this category are at risk of significant disruption by 2030.

Automation timeline (2025–2030)
- 2025: 22% of tasks automatable
- 2027: 40% of tasks automatable
- 2030: 58% of tasks automatable
Salary trajectory
Current median: $49,080. Projected 2030 median: $50,000.
Tasks most at risk
- Shipment tracking
- Carrier rate lookup
- Routine BOL processing
Tasks that resist automation
- Exception management
- Carrier negotiation
- Shipper relationship
